New temporary exhibition: ‘Aviation Pioneers in the Three-Lake Region’. The area around Murten was one of the true birthplaces of Swiss aviation in the 1910s. Figures such as Ernest Failloubaz, ‘the flying kid’, René Grandjean, Charles Favre and Georges Cailler shaped this era with courage, technical skill and a great pioneering spirit. Particular mention must be made of René Grandjean, who was the first to design an aircraft that could be fitted with skis, wheels and floats. These aircraft were built using the simplest of means, yet were ingenious, thanks to local support from blacksmiths and wheelwrights.
